Finding the Right Container: Sales vs. Rentals in Newport
Okay, so you're convinced containers are awesome, but what's the deal with buying versus renting? This is where Newport container sales and rentals really comes into play, and it all depends on your specific needs. Container sales are perfect if you have a long-term plan. Maybe you're building a permanent structure, need a dedicated storage facility for your business, or want to create a unique dwelling. Buying gives you full ownership and the freedom to modify the container exactly as you wish. You can cut, weld, insulate, and decorate it to your heart's content. The upfront cost might be higher, but over time, it can be more economical if you plan to use it for years. You’ll want to look for photos of new or used containers that fit your budget and quality requirements. Used containers can be a fantastic bargain, but make sure to inspect them carefully for rust, dents, and structural integrity – good photos and detailed descriptions from the seller are essential here. On the other hand, container rentals are ideal for short-term needs. Think about a construction project that requires temporary on-site storage for tools and materials, a business needing extra inventory space during a busy season, or even for event setups. Renting offers flexibility. You get the space you need without the long-term commitment or the large capital expenditure. This is a great way to 'try before you buy' or to handle temporary fluctuations in demand. Photos of rental units often focus on their clean, ready-to-use condition and efficient delivery options. When comparing, always consider the duration you'll need the container, your budget, and whether you plan to modify it. Newport providers usually have a range of options available for both scenarios, so checking out their inventory photos is your first step to finding the perfect fit.
Key Considerations When Buying or Renting
When you're diving into Newport container sales and rentals, there are a few crucial things to keep in mind, guys. First off, condition is king, especially if you're buying used. Check the photos meticulously! Look for rust, especially around the roof, corners, and door seals. Dents are usually cosmetic, but major structural damage is a no-go. 'One-trip' containers (used only once for shipping) are often the best balance of cost and condition – they're practically new. For rentals, you generally get a well-maintained unit, but still, ask about its condition and any specific features it has. Size matters, too. The most common are 20-foot and 40-foot standard containers, but high-cube (HC) versions offer an extra foot of vertical space, which can be a game-changer for living or working spaces. Make sure the photos clearly indicate the dimensions. Delivery and placement are HUGE. Can the provider deliver to your exact location? Do you have adequate access for a large truck and crane? Factor in delivery costs; they can add up! Some providers offer package deals that include delivery, which is super convenient. Lastly, modifications. If you plan on cutting doors, windows, or adding insulation, make sure the container you buy is suitable for modification and that you understand any local regulations or permits needed. For rentals, modifications are usually not allowed, so clarify this upfront. Don't be shy about asking questions and requesting more photos if the ones provided aren't clear enough. Your due diligence now will save you headaches later!
Exploring Newport Container Options: A Visual Guide
Let's get visual, people! Exploring Newport container sales and rentals is best done by looking at the actual photos of what's available and what can be done. When you check out a supplier's website or brochure, you'll typically see a range of options. There are the standard 'Dry Van' containers, which are your workhorses for general storage and basic modifications. They come in various conditions, from 'as-is' cargo-worthy units to pristine 'one-trip' options. Then you have 'Refrigerated' or 'Reefer' containers, which are insulated and equipped with a cooling unit – perfect for businesses needing temperature-controlled storage, like restaurants or florists. While these are specialized, you might find them available for sale or rent too. High-Cube containers, as we mentioned, offer that extra height, making them feel much more spacious inside. Many photos will highlight the difference between a standard and a high-cube interior. Beyond the basic types, you'll see examples of customized containers. These are the real showstoppers! Think about photos of containers transformed into stylish coffee kiosks with serving windows, portable artist studios with skylights, or even compact home offices with built-in desks and shelving. Some suppliers even specialize in modifying containers to your exact specifications before delivery. These 'pre-fab' options can save you a ton of time and hassle. When looking at these photos, pay attention to the details: the quality of the welds, the type of insulation used (if any), the finish of the doors and windows, and the overall aesthetic.
